Consumers warned over premium costs

As the cost of living continues to rise and consumers find their personal finances stretched, an industry figure has warned people considering buying a property on a flood plain to think about the cost of home insurance for the property.
The warning, from moneysupermarket.com, comes after the Association of British Insurers (ABI) and the government reached an agreement which will ensure home insurance remains available to property owners at risk of flooding.
A plan of action has been formulated by the two parties that will see the government implement a long-term investment strategy, which will set out strategic flood prevention aims.
Other parts of the agreement include promoting access to home insurance for low-income households and raising awareness in areas where flood risks are significant.
A spokesperson for the price comparison site is warning consumers they should consider the cost of insuring their property if it is an area which is at risk of flood damage.
"I urge anyone planning to buy a home on a flood plain to think carefully about the impact location might have on their premiums," the representative said.
Graeme Trudgill, technical and corporate affairs executive at the British Insurance Brokers' Association, recently warned property owners who live in parts of the country which are susceptible to flooding to install flood defences on their houses in order to obtain insurance cover.
